Abstract: | We present a method to construct the geometric model of the pulmonary arteries from a set of cardiac CT scan images. It is desired that the model is in rectangular meshes. The main difficulties in this work are insufficient resolution along z-direction, the requirement of the rectangular meshes, and the geometric shape of the pulmonary arteries. We present a method that is based on estimation the medial axis and the radii of the vessel along the axis. We evaluate the proposed method using a phantom data set. The proposed method can achieve good reconstructed result for the phantom data set. |
